Controlled burns planned for this week in the Jemez Wilderness

Posted at: 10/15/2012 2:26 PM | Updated at: 10/15/2012 3:03 PM
By: KOB.com staff

If you see smoke near the Jemez Wilderness over the next few weeks, don't panic.

The U.S. Forest Service will be conducting several large controlled burns in the wilderness this fall.

One of these burns is scheduled to start on Wednesday.

According to the Forest Service, recent blazes such as the Wallow Fire in Arizona demonstrate the need to carefully manage the growth of forests.

The Forest Service says that smoke from the controlled burn may affect Albuquerque.
